A $700 camera became a very expensive chew toy for a cheeky sled dog in Greenland, prompting a night-time search by journalists from The Associated Press.

When a 360 degree camera went missing during a shoot in the Arctic circle, the AP crew eventually found it among sled dogs they’d been filming with earlier.

After the crew recovered the camera, they discovered a dog had taken it and had also hit record.

The footage shows the dog chewing the camera, and then running with it, before hiding it underneath a sled.

AP journalists were in the Arctic to cover global events affecting the autonomous territory.
